Rapidform XOR, the only 3G (third-generation) reverse engineering software, is a complete software application for creating CAD models from 3D scan data. With Rapidform XOR, you can open data from any 3D scanner and quickly create editable, parametric solid models of virtually any physical object. These models can be transferred from XOR into popular CAD applications, including SolidWorks®, Siemens NX™ and Pro/ENGINEER®, with complete feature trees intact. This means that – unlike second generation reverse engineering software – the models from XOR are editable just like any other part designed in CAD. And XOR can save models as Parasolid®, STP, IGS and STL for use in any CAD/CAM/CAE application.

The third-generation parametric reverse engineering approach inside XOR makes creating high quality, ready to manufacture CAD models fast and easy. Creating complete solid models accurate to within a few microns of a 3D scan takes less time than redrawing it in CAD. XOR, paired with a 3D scanner, is simply the fastest, most accurate way to create a design model of a real-world object.

XOR Features:

  • Collect data in real time with a liveScan™ enabled 3D scanner
  • Import point clouds or meshes from any scanner or other source
  • Convert raw scans into high quality polygon mesh models
    - 4 step Mesh Buildup Wizard™ for automated point cloud » optimized mesh processing
  • Reduce polygon mesh file size without losing accuracy
  • CAE-ready mesh optimization
  • Create NURBS surface models for use in CAD/CAM and other downstream applications
    - Auto-surfacing: Complete surface models in two clicks
    - Interactive surfacing: Professional level curve & surface modeling for demanding applications
  • Automatically extract the original design intent of a scanned part (patent-pending Redesign Assistant™)
    - Extrude, revolve, loft & sweep to make CAD models, using scan data as a template
    - Fillet & chamfer with automatic radius/angle calculation
  • Create CAD solids and surfaces directly from polygon meshes or point clouds
  • Create 2D & 3D sketches from scan data automatically
  • Create loft surfaces with 2 step Loft Wizard™ (patent-pending)
  • Build complete feature trees with modeling history
  • Monitor accuracy of CAD to scan in real time while modeling (patent-pending Accuracy Analyzer™)
  • Transfer parametric models, with feature trees, into: - SolidWorks (2006+, any edition)
    - UG NX (4+)
    - Pro/Engineer Wildfire (3.0+)
    - After transfer, data from XOR behaves the same as native models in each software
  • Output to CATIA, Inventor, Solid Edge and other applications via Parasolid, IGES, STEP, STL, etc.
  • Automatically refit original CAD data (As-designed) to scan data (As-built)

Rapidform XOV is the ideal solution for inspecting parts with a 3D scanner. It borrows a powerful concept from the CAD world: every inspection job generates a history tree, so you can easily modify or repeat the inspection process any time. XOV combines in-depth inspection functionality with highly accurate algorithms certified and tested by leading metrology labs. And it reads native files from Siemens NX, CATIA V5 and Pro/ENGINEER, including dimensions, tolerances and datums.

Rapidform XOV Features:

  • Collect data or measure design features instantly in real time with a liveScan™ enabled 3D scanner
  • Import point clouds or meshes from any scanner or other source
    - De-noise and optimize scan data for more accurate inspection results with a rich set of scan data tools
  • Import native CAD models from any CAD software
    - Compatible with Siemens NX, CATIA and Pro/ENGINEER
    - Native file import available Siemens NX, CATIA and Pro/ENGINEER with native GD&T annotations
    - Support standard neutral files such as IGES, STEP and VDAFS
    - Available to use mesh data (tessellated CAD or scan data) as a nominal data
  • Automatically recognize design features on CAD, mesh data and scan data to be measured
  • Align scan data to CAD data using a variety of proven alignment methods
    - Industry-proven accurate datum-based, 3-2-1, RPS target reference N-points, section profile and best-fit alignments
    - Intelligent auto-align feature based on automatic feature recognition
  • Compare CAD and scan (or scan and scan) with color maps
  • Measure GD&T as well as conventional +/- tolerances
    - Extensive GD&T support based on ANSI Y14.5B 1994 standards
    - Fully support conventional 2D type GD&T and +/- tolerances on 2D drafts
  • Perform specialized measurements
    - Boundary, silhouette curve, virtual edge and reference geometry deviation color mapping
    - Pre-defined comparison point deviation analysis
  • Generate detailed inspection reports automatically
  • Generate trend analysis reports for multiple parts
  • Repeat any inspection without writing macro code (100% automatic inspection with class-leading repeatability)
